Hi All,

I have a Dell desktop PC and a Dell Laptop PC, both of which came with
OEM versions of WindowsXP Pro.

The hard-drive on my desktop crashed a few days ago, and I am about to
purchase a replacement for it. I haven't been able to find the OEM
WinXP Pro CD that came with my desktop, however I do still have the
OEM WinXP Pro CD that came with my laptop.

I do still have the registration key for the WinXP Pro installation
that was on my desktop, and I'm wondering if it's possible to use the
CD that came with my laptop but supply the registration key that came
with my desktop, to install WinXP Pro on the new hard-drive?

In essence, I'm hoping I can save myself the cost of buying another
copy of WinXP Pro, since the installation on the desktop has now been
destroyed.

Can anyone tell me if this is possible, or are registration keys tied
to specific installation CDs?

My guess is they will work.
But the CDs may be different.
If they are different, there may be problems.
Compare the invoices or other documentation with each computer to help
determine if they were the same as shipped.
Otherwise you should contact Dell, they are the experts on their CDs.
